OK, we have seen the thread to build the ultimate (no expense spared) road bike, so let us try to build the ultimate Commuter/Tourer, as I figure this is closer to what most people reaaaaly want.

This bike will be doing say 1000 miles or 2000 kilometers as a commuter bike, per annum so swift gear changing, lots of road response, and carrying the expensive laptop. Followed by doing a couple of tours a year of say 1000 miles or 2000 kilometers fully loaded with the tent etc. It's going to be used all year round and the place is either Europe or North America.

I'll start with the frame which will be the Thorn Nomad

http://www.sjscycles.com/thornbrochure.asp

Yours for only about £350 or $500, and you will notice comes with 26" wheels
